In Induction heating power supply is one of the important equipment for inductionheating process, from the principle of speaking, it is a kind of AC power into DC to ACpower supply frequency we need equipment.Induction heating power supply inverter control circuit at this stage by the analogdevices, PLL circuit such as the use of integrated phase-locked loop CD4046. But this kind ofcontrol circuit structure is complex, it excited signal, dead time, overlap time must beimplemented by the auxiliary circuit, unable to realize the phase locking function, so thetracking of narrow range.This paper analyzes the principle and the inverter induction heating control requirements.According to the current trend of induction heating equipment gradually digitized, the DSPchip is used in the inverter induction heating power control, the successful implementation ofthe frequency tracking and fixed angle control. At the same time it shock signal, theoverlapping area control is implemented by DSP to simplify the circuit structure. DSPpowerful computing capability based on output signal, to optimize the compensation, theoutput signal stability is improved.The design of the inverter control circuitry needed, including DSP power circuit, JTAGinterface circuit, DSP chip high speed crossing zero comparison circuit, level convertingcircuit, power amplifier circuit and protection circuit.Finally through the experiment, verify the feasibility and accuracy of the design.Analysis of the experimental results, the design ideas for further improvement.
